Built to exacting engineering tolerances, this Aluminum 6061 stock sheet is a premier choice for applications demanding a balance of strength, formability, and corrosion resistance. Its 0.202-inch thickness, coupled with a 44-inch length and 30-inch width, makes it suitable for precision machining, structural components, and custom fabrications. The inherent properties of 6061 alloy, including its excellent weldability and heat-treatability to T6 temper, ensure reliable performance in aerospace, automotive, marine, and general engineering sectors where structural integrity and lightweight design are paramount.

| ❌ Mistake | ✅ Correct Approach |
|---|---|
| Using a general-purpose saw blade not designed for aluminum. | Employ a carbide-tipped or high-speed steel blade with a coarse tooth pitch formulated for cutting non-ferrous metals like aluminum to prevent binding and overheating. |
| Inadequate clamping of the stock sheet. | Utilize robust clamps and vises to firmly secure the sheet, ensuring it remains stationary throughout the cutting process to prevent accidental movement and ensure precise dimensions. |
